Abstract

The present work was carried out to evaluate the in vitro and in vivo antibacterial activity of florfenicol, ciprofloxacin and oxyteteracycline against Aeromonas hyDROPhila pathogen in Clarias lazera fish with especial references to their effect on some hematological and biochemical parameters , and lastly to determine the concentration of these tested drugs at different time intervals using microbiological assay .This work was carried out on 445 Clarias lazera . Firstly 5 group each of 10 fish were designed to determine the in vivo and in vitro efficacy ,then secondary 8 groups each of 10 were done to determine the effect of these drugs on some hematological and biochemical parameters, and lastly 7 groups were designed to determine the concentrations of these drugs at different time intervals .The in vitro activity indicated that ciprofloxacin was the more powerfull tested drug follwed by florfenicol and oxytetracycline .Also the in vivo antibacterial activity of these tested drugs by their therapeutic doses showed a decline in mortality rates and pathogenic clinical signs compared to that infected non medicated group. Also it was found that both ciprofloxacin and oxytetracycline cause significant decrease in all hematological parameters while florfenicol cause slight decrease in hematological picture , and all these changes were reversible and retuned to the normal within 7 days of treatment .The biochemical analysis of serum was carried out to estimate the liver function test( AST&ALT) , kidney function tests(Urea& Creatinine) and the protein fractions ( total protein & albumin and globulin) , the results showed that florfenicol cause non significant changes in all biochemical parameters compared to the control group . .The highest concentration of florfenicol , ciprofloxacin and oxytetracycline in serum was at (10, 4, 12 ) and ( 8, 2, 12 ) of clinically healthy and experimentally infected Claris lazera with A. hyDROPhila pathogen respectively then gradually declined by time .
